SLINGER, Wis. — Reigning Slinger Super Speedway super late model champion R.J. Braun started his season on a high note by winning Sunday’s Miracle at the High Banks 100 season opener for the ASA Midwest Tour at the famous high-banked quarter-mile oval. “He didn’t have enough laps and I think lapped cars got in the way. On the restart, Braun and Nottestad put on a spirited side-by-side battle for the lead until Braun would get by Nottestad on lap 38. After the caution flew on lap 60 for Barrett Polhemus’s spin, Braun and Nottestad would renew their battle for the top spot, but this time with Apel joining them. Nottestad and Braun would trade the lead back and fourth for four laps, until Braun took back the lead for good on lap 65. He knew what he had to do with lap cars and certain positions on the track.
